CNC, also called numerical control, is an automated processing technology that uses digital computers to control the movement of machine tools. This technology is convenient, efficient and accurate, and is widely used in CNC machine tools, machining centers, automation equipment and other fields. The development of CNC has improved the level of mechanical manufacturing and processing, and some traditional manual processing techniques have been replaced, greatly improving productivity and production efficiency. At the same time, CNC machine tools can also perform complex engraving, drilling, milling, printing and other processes, becoming important production equipment in many industries.
CNC technology is widely used in aerospace, automobile manufacturing, machinery manufacturing, electronic communications, precision instruments and other industries. The aerospace field requires the manufacture of a large number of parts, components, components, etc., with extremely high precision requirements. CNC technology plays an important role in this field. The automobile manufacturing industry is also gradually transforming to CNC technology. The processing and production efficiency of body parts has been greatly improved, and the product accuracy is higher. The machinery manufacturing industry is one of the earliest fields where CNC technology is widely used. Because it can greatly improve production efficiency and precision, it is widely used in the industry. The field of electronic communications includes the manufacturing of many precision instruments, which involves a large amount of internal installation and migration. The widespread application of CNC technology makes complex and delicate instrument processing easier to achieve.
In general, CNC technology has a wide range of applications. Thanks to its high efficiency and accuracy, it is valued and applied by more and more industries.
